Why is the Boruto manga so different from the anime?

The manga focuses on the important events while the anime added scenes and arcs to delve deeper into the story and the characters. As mentioned, the manga is concise and does not spend time on minor characters as much unlike the anime. In fact, the anime added characters that are not seen in the manga yet.

Is Boruto manga 2022 finished?

The Boruto manga is not going away anytime soon. It is still ongoing, with 17 manga volumes released so far. However, Mikio Ikemoto plans to end the manga at volume 30. This will bring the Naruto saga to a close after 100 volumes from beginning to end.

How far is the one piece manga from the anime?

There is a certain gap between anime and Manga For instance, a long-running anime like One Piece has a 40 Chapter's gap between it and manga. It is something that they maintained to ensure that even if the Mangaka gets on a break the anime can still follow certain episodes before they can run any filler episodes.

What is the first arc of Boruto?

In the Boruto manga, the very first arc served as a re-telling of the events of the Boruto: Naruto The Movie by Masashi Kishimoto. In the anime's case, the story began with Boruto Uzumaki's admission into the Ninja Academy of Konoha. From there onwards, an anime-original arc focusing on Boruto Uzumaki's time in the Academy ran for about a year.

Is Boruto in the Academy?

Since the Boruto: Naruto Next Generations anime begins with Boruto's days in the Academy, it's only natural to see more characters being involved in it. Boruto's Academy has seen lots of ninja aspirants that haven't made their way to the manga yet, such as Iwabee Yuino, and Denki Kaminari.
